MSA-0986
Cascadable Silicon Bipolar MMIC Amplifier
Data Sheet
Description
The MSA-0986 is a high performance silicon bipolar
Monolithic Microwave Integrated Circuit (MMIC)
housed in a low cost, surface mount plastic package.
This MMIC is designed for very wide bandwidth indus-
trial and commercial applications that require flat gain
and low VSWR.
The MSA-series is fabricated using Avago’s 10 GHz fT,
25 GHz fMAX, silicon bipolar MMIC process which uses
nitride self-alignment, ion implantation, and gold
metallization to achieve excellent performance,
uniformity and reliability. The use of an external bias
resistor for temperature and current stability also allows
bias flexibility.
Features
• Broadband, Minimum Ripple Cascadable 50Ω Gain Block
• 7.2 ± 0.5 dB Typical Gain Flatness from 0.1 to 3.0 GHz
• 3 dB Bandwidth: 0.1 to 5.5 GHz
• 10.5 dBm Typical P1dB at 2.0 GHz
• Surface Mount Plastic Package
• Tape-and-Reel Packaging Option Available
• Lead-free Option Available
